Fight erupts over $52m estate of convicted businessman – The Age
The widow and children of Melbourne businessman Nabil Grege, who died in April after a long illness, are quarreling over his estate.

The comically bungled 2013 scheme saw police recover incriminating documents that had been tossed in a food court rubbish bin, as well as Greges associates collecting the wrong shipping container from the port and the drop-off driver leaving the rendezvous with the only set of keys to the delivery truck.
Wiretaps revealed Greges penchant for extremely colourful language when things went wrong, including lambasting associates as the brother of a slut or a donkey.
